/// Ingests [IngestionEntry] from the given stream into a the passed [DirectoryService].
|
|
/// On success, returns the root [Node].
|
|
///
|
|
/// The stream must have the following invariants:
|
|
/// - All children entries must come before their parents.
|
|
/// - The last entry must be the root node which must have a single path component.
|
|
/// - Every entry should have a unique path, and only consist of normal components.
|
|
/// This means, no windows path prefixes, absolute paths, `.` or `..`.
|
|
/// - All referenced directories must have an associated directory entry in the stream.
|
|
/// This means if there is a file entry for `foo/bar`, there must also be a `foo` directory
|
|
/// entry.
|
|
///
|
|
/// Internally we maintain a [HashMap] of [PathBuf] to partially populated [Directory] at that
|
|
/// path. Once we receive an [IngestionEntry] for the directory itself, we remove it from the
|
|
/// map and upload it to the [DirectoryService] through a lazily created [DirectoryPutter].
|
|
///
|
|
/// On success, returns the root node.
